    The Costus Igneus, is a remarkable herb native to Southeast Asia, particularly India. Its history is intertwined with traditional medicine systems like Ayurveda, where it has been revered for its potential to assist in managing diabetes.

    Origin and Appearance

    This herb typically thrives in tropical and subtropical regions. Its most distinctive feature is its lush, green leaves that bear a striking resemblance to elongated teardrops. They are glossy, smooth, and possess a slightly reddish tint at the base. When fully grown, the Insulin Plant can reach heights of about 2 to 4 feet, making it an accessible addition to home gardens and natural remedies.

    insulin plant for diabetes

    Traditional Uses

    Throughout history, the Insulin Plant has been used for various health purposes, including treating diabetes. Its leaves are often consumed to harness its potential benefits. Traditional practices have incorporated the fresh leaves or shade-dried leaf powder into daily diets as a complementary approach to diabetes management.

    Insulin Plant Key Compounds Responsible for Benefits

    The magic of the Insulin Plant lies in its bioactive compounds, which contribute to its potential health benefits. While research is ongoing, some key compounds have been identified, such as alkaloids, flavonoids, and essential oils. These compounds are believed to influence glucose metabolism and insulin sensitivity, making the Insulin Plant an intriguing natural remedy for diabetes.

    How to Eat Insulin Plant: Methods of Use

    Incorporating the Insulin Plant into your diabetes management regimen is a straightforward process. There are several methods of using this herbal remedy:

    1. Fresh Leaves: You can consume fresh leaves of the Insulin Plant by chewing them directly or adding them to salads and dishes for a subtle flavor.
    2. Leaf Powder: For convenience, many opt for shade-dried leaf powder, which can be mixed with water or sprinkled over meals.

    Dosage and Frequency

    The appropriate dosage may vary from person to person, and it’s essential to consult with a healthcare provider or herbalist for personalized guidance. Generally, a teaspoon of shade-dried leaf powder or a fresh leaf daily is a common starting point.

    Incorporating Into Your Diet

    To make the Insulin Plant a seamless part of your daily routine, consider blending it into diabetes-friendly recipes. Smoothies, herbal teas, or incorporating it into vegetable dishes can add a healthy twist to your diet.

    Safety and Precautions

    Safety First: Considerations for Usage

    As with any herbal remedy, it’s crucial to be aware of potential side effects and interactions, especially if you’re currently taking medications. Here are some safety considerations:

    1. Insulin Plant Side Effects: While generally safe, some individuals might experience mild gastrointestinal discomfort or allergic reactions. If you notice any side effects, stop consuming and consult a healthcare professional.
    2. Medication Interactions: The Insulin Plant may interact with diabetes medications, potentially leading to low blood sugar levels (hypoglycemia). It’s vital to monitor blood sugar closely when incorporating this herb into your regimen, under the guidance of a healthcare provider.

    Recommendations for Complications

    If you have diabetes-related complications or other underlying health issues, it’s even more critical to consult with a healthcare provider before using herbal remedies like the Insulin Plant. They can provide tailored guidance and ensure your safety.
